Should you sleep straight after night shift, stay awake, or have a short sleep and get up?
The answer depends on one important question: are you working another night shift, or have you just finished your final night shift?
In this episode, Night Shift & Sleep Specialist Roger Sutherland explains how to recover after night shift, why your recovery strategy should change depending on your roster, and how sleep, daylight, movement and food timing can help you transition through and out of night shift.
If you work night shift, rotating shifts or irregular hours and struggle to recover after working nights, this episode will help you understand what to do when you get home.
